Why is Nichrome used as a heating element?

Nichrome, a non-magnetic 80/20 alloy of nickel and chromium, is the most common resistance wire for heating purposes because it has a high resistivity and resistance to oxidation at high temperatures. When used as a heating element, it is usually wound into coils.

What does Nichrome wire do?

Nichrome wire is an alloy made from nickel and chromium. It resists heat and oxidation and serves as a heating element in products such as toasters and hair dryers. Hobbyists use nichrome wire in ceramic sculpture and glassmaking. The wire can also be found in laboratories, construction and specialized electronics.

What is the cause of heating effect of current?

When an electric current is passed through a conductor, it generates heat due to the hindrance caused by the conductor to the flowing current. The work done in overcoming the hindrance to the current generates heat in that conductor.

How does an element work?

A typical heating element is usually a coil, ribbon (straight or corrugated), or strip of wire that gives off heat much like a lamp filament. When an electric current flows through it, it glows red hot and converts the electrical energy passing through it into heat, which it radiates out in all directions.

How does a PTC heating element work?

PTC heaters utilize Positive Temperature Coefficient materials i.e. materials that exhibit a positive resistance change in response to the increase in temperature. Simply put, the material allows current to pass when it's cold, and restricts current to flow as the threshold temperature increases.

Do you have to drain the hot water heater to change element?

Shut off the cold water inlet valve, located on top of the tank. Connect a garden hose to the drain at the bottom of the tank and open the drain valve. You only have to drain the unit to a point below the element, but it is a good idea to completely flush the tank anytime you are making repairs.

Will a water heater work with one element?

Yes, a water heater can still run if the bottom element quits. In most water heaters, the top heating element controls the thermostat and will still work even if the bottom element fails. So provided the top heating element is working, it can still produce some hot water even if the bottom heating element fails.

How do you Ohm a heating element?

Touch a probe on the multitester to each screw on the element. If you get no reading, or a maximum reading, the element is bad. Elements do have some resistance, so a reading of 10-16 ohms is normal, with higher ohm readings for 3,500 watt elements and lower readings for 5,500 watt elements.

Should a heating element have continuity?

To determine if the heating element is at fault, first use a multimeter to test the heating element for continuity. If the heating element does not have continuity, replace it. Next, test for continuity from each terminal to the case. If the heating element has continuity to the case, it is shorted out.

What causes a heating element to burn out in a water heater?

The most common cause of burned out elements on new water heater installations or new element replacements is DRYFIRE. This happens because the installer fails to open a hot water faucet while the heater tank is filling with water and therefore purging or bleeding air from the system.
